Understanding Vinyl Fence Components

Vinyl fences are made up of various components that contribute to their overall functionality and aesthetic appeal. Here, we delve into the essential parts used in vinyl fencing:

1. Pickets

Pickets are the vertical boards that make up the main body of the fence. They come in various styles, such as flat-topped or scalloped, allowing for a range of design options. The thickness and height of the pickets can also affect the level of privacy and protection a fence provides.

2. Rails

Rails are the horizontal supports that connect the pickets. Typically, there are two or three rails in a standard vinyl fence, depending on the design. They provide structural integrity and can vary in height and width.

3. Posts

Posts are the vertical supports that anchor the entire fence. Made of solid vinyl, they are designed to withstand the elements and provide stability. Posts can be customized with decorative caps to enhance the fence’s appearance.

4. Gates

Gates offer access points and can be designed to match the overall style of the fence. Vinyl gates come in various widths and heights and include hardware for smooth operation.

5. Caps and Inserts

Caps are decorative elements placed on top of the fence posts. Inserts are used to fill in spaces within the fence. Both can be customized to reflect personal style preferences or complement the home’s architecture.

6. Hardware

Hardware includes the hinges, latches, and other mechanisms necessary for gate functionality. Quality hardware is crucial for the longevity and ease of use of the gates.

Benefits of Vinyl Fencing

Vinyl fencing offers numerous advantages over traditional materials such as wood or metal. Below are some of the key benefits:

1. Low Maintenance

Unlike wood fences, which require regular staining or painting, vinyl fences are virtually maintenance-free. They can be easily cleaned with soap and water, and they do not rot, warp, or splinter.

2. Durability

Vinyl fences are designed to withstand harsh weather conditions, including strong winds, heavy rain, and intense sunlight, without fading or cracking. This durability ensures that your fence will last for many years with minimal upkeep.

3. Aesthetic Appeal

Vinyl fences come in various colors, styles, and textures, allowing homeowners to choose a design that enhances their property’s curb appeal. Options like wood grain finishes can replicate the look of traditional wood while retaining the benefits of vinyl.

4. Safety

Vinyl fencing is a safe option for families with children or pets. The lack of sharp edges or splinters makes it a secure choice for play areas and gardens.

5. Eco-Friendly

Many vinyl fences are made from recycled materials, making them a more environmentally friendly choice compared to traditional wood fencing. This aspect can appeal to eco-conscious consumers.

Installation Tips for Vinyl Fencing

Installing a vinyl fence can be a straightforward process, provided you follow some essential guidelines. Here are some tips to ensure a successful installation:

1. Plan Your Layout

Before you start, measure the area where the fence will be installed. Mark the locations of the posts and determine the fence’s height and style to ensure you have all the necessary parts.

2. Gather Necessary Tools and Materials

3. Install the Posts

Begin by digging holes for the posts, ensuring they are deep enough to provide stability. Set the posts in concrete and allow them to cure before attaching the rails and pickets.

4. Attach the Rails and Pickets

Once the posts are secure, attach the horizontal rails at the desired heights. After securing the rails, install the pickets, ensuring they are evenly spaced for a professional look.

5. Add Gates and Hardware

Finally, install the gate and any necessary hardware. Double-check that everything opens and closes smoothly and that all parts are secure.

FAQ

What are the main benefits of vinyl fencing?
Vinyl fencing is low-maintenance, durable, aesthetically pleasing, safe for families, and eco-friendly, making it a popular choice among homeowners.

How long does vinyl fencing last?
Vinyl fencing can last decades, often with a lifespan of 20-30 years or more, depending on the quality of materials and installation.

Is vinyl fencing safe for pets and children?
Yes, vinyl fencing has no sharp edges or splinters, making it a safe option for pets and children.

Can I install vinyl fencing myself?
While it is possible to install vinyl fencing as a DIY project, it is essential to follow proper guidelines and have the right tools for a successful installation.

What colors and styles are available for vinyl fencing?
Vinyl fencing comes in a variety of colors, styles, and textures, including options that mimic the appearance of wood.

How do I clean my vinyl fence?
Cleaning a vinyl fence involves using soap and water, along with a soft brush or cloth to remove dirt and stains.

Is vinyl fencing more expensive than wood?
While the initial cost of vinyl fencing may be higher than wood, it offers long-term savings due to its durability and low maintenance requirements.

What should I consider when choosing a vinyl fence?
Consider factors such as height, style, purpose (privacy, security, decoration), and budget when selecting a vinyl fence.

Are there warranties for vinyl fencing products?
Many manufacturers offer warranties that can cover defects and fading, so it’s essential to check the warranty details before purchasing.
